* {{Ghostwriter}}: In 1975, Roberto was diagnosed with cancer and Kim stopped working on the strip herself to care for him, She hired a London-based British cartoonist named Bill Asprey to handle it and he has done so ever since, but the strip is still published with her name and signature. Sadly, Roberto died the following year. Kim went on to manage the business side of the franchise until her death in 1997, and one of her and Roberto's sons manages it to this day.
